The USA-based Lux Interna has signed a multi-album deal with Auerbach Tonträger, which will release its new studio album in 2025.
Lux Interna's guitarist and vocalist Joshua Levi Ian writes on behalf of the band: "After a lengthy hiatus, we're thrilled to announce that Lux Interna is embarking on an exciting new chapter. With the upcoming release of our album, we're joining the talented and diverse roster at Prophecy Productions, a label whose international orientation and dedication to the aesthetic and conceptual commitments of its artists align perfectly with our vision. Prophecy are able to truly support the multimedia dimensions of our new work that we're about to release, which is our most immersive and rich work to date. We look forward to reconnecting with old fans and welcoming new ones, both at home and abroad, as we dive into this next stage of our journey. Thanks to Martin, Rayshele, Łukasz, and everybody else at the Prophecy team for the partnership!"
Lux Interna's music has been described as "Apocalyptic Americana" or "rural noir". The band's latest album intricately weaves together a rich tapestry of musical influences such as desert blues, Appalachian folk, doom, gospel, gothic, psychedelia, post-punk, and even warped elements of 60s girl pop and 80s new wave. Ultimately, however, Lux Interna's music is unmistakably its own – a sound that is intimate and cinematic. Link
